تصویر کی نمائندگی ہو سکتی ہے۔
پروڈکٹ کی تفصیلات کے لیے وضاحتیں دیکھیں۔
SPC5516EBMLQ66

SPC5516EBMLQ66

Overview

Category: Microcontroller
Use: Embedded Systems
Characteristics: High-performance, low-power consumption
Package: LQFP-64
Essence: Advanced microcontroller for automotive applications
Packaging/Quantity: Tray / 250 units per tray

Specifications

  • Architecture: Power Architecture®
  • Core: e200z4d
  • Clock Frequency: Up to 80 MHz
  • Flash Memory: 1 MB
  • RAM: 128 KB
  • Operating Voltage: 2.7V - 5.5V
  • Operating Temperature Range: -40°C to +125°C
  • I/O Pins: 48
  • Communication Interfaces: CAN, LIN, FlexRay, SPI, I2C, UART
  • Analog-to-Digital Converter (ADC): 12-bit, 16 channels
  • Timers: 32-bit, up to 8 channels
  • Watchdog Timer: Yes
  • Package Type: LQFP (Low Profile Quad Flat Package)
  • Package Dimensions: 10mm x 10mm
  • Package Pin Count: 64

Detailed Pin Configuration

The SPC5516EBMLQ66 microcontroller has a total of 64 pins. The pin configuration is as follows:

  • Pins 1-8: Digital I/O
  • Pins 9-16: Analog Inputs
  • Pins 17-24: Communication Interfaces (CAN, LIN, FlexRay)
  • Pins 25-32: Serial Peripheral Interface (SPI)
  • Pins 33-40: Inter-Integrated Circuit (I2C)
  • Pins 41-48: Universal Asynchronous Receiver-Transmitter (UART)
  • Pins 49-56: Timers
  • Pins 57-64: Power and Ground

Functional Features

  1. High-performance microcontroller suitable for automotive applications.
  2. Low-power consumption, making it ideal for battery-powered systems.
  3. Supports various communication interfaces such as CAN, LIN, FlexRay, SPI, I2C, and UART.
  4. Integrated analog-to-digital converter (ADC) for precise measurement and control.
  5. Multiple timers for accurate timing and event management.
  6. Built-in watchdog timer for system reliability.
  7. Wide operating voltage range and temperature range for versatile applications.

Advantages and Disadvantages

Advantages: - High-performance architecture for demanding applications. - Low-power consumption extends battery life. - Versatile communication interfaces enable connectivity with other devices. - Ample flash memory and RAM for data storage and processing. - Robust package design for durability in automotive environments.

Disadvantages: - Limited pin count may restrict the number of peripherals that can be connected simultaneously. - Higher cost compared to lower-end microcontrollers. - Steeper learning curve due to advanced features and complex programming requirements.

Working Principles

The SPC5516EBMLQ66 microcontroller is based on the Power Architecture® and utilizes the e200z4d core. It operates at clock frequencies of up to 80 MHz and features a combination of high-performance computing capabilities and low-power consumption. The microcontroller integrates various peripherals and communication interfaces, allowing it to interface with sensors, actuators, and other components in an embedded system.

The microcontroller executes instructions stored in its flash memory and processes data using its internal RAM. It communicates with external devices through its I/O pins and dedicated communication interfaces such as CAN, LIN, FlexRay, SPI, I2C, and UART. The integrated ADC enables precise analog signal conversion, while the timers facilitate accurate timing and event management.

Detailed Application Field Plans

The SPC5516EBMLQ66 microcontroller is widely used in automotive applications, including:

  1. Engine Control Units (ECUs)
  2. Body Control Modules (BCMs)
  3. Advanced Driver Assistance Systems (ADAS)
  4. Infotainment Systems
  5. Electric Power Steering (EPS) Systems
  6. Transmission Control Units (TCUs)
  7. Lighting Control Modules
  8. Climate Control Systems

Its high-performance capabilities, low-power consumption, and extensive communication interfaces make it suitable for various automotive subsystems that require reliable and efficient control.

Detailed and Complete Alternative Models

  1. SPC560B50L5: Similar microcontroller with enhanced security features.
  2. MPC5744P: Higher-end microcontroller with increased processing power.
  3. S32K144: Cost-effective microcontroller with a focus on automotive applications.
  4. STM32F446: Microcontroller with a wide range of peripherals and communication interfaces.
  5. PIC32MZ2048EFH144: Microcontroller with a large flash memory capacity and advanced peripherals.

These alternative models offer different features and specifications, allowing developers to choose the most suitable

تکنیکی حل میں SPC5516EBMLQ66 کے اطلاق سے متعلق 10 عام سوالات اور جوابات کی فہرست بنائیں

Sure! Here are 10 common questions and answers related to the application of SPC5516EBMLQ66 in technical solutions:

  1. Question: What is SPC5516EBMLQ66?
    Answer: SPC5516EBMLQ66 is a microcontroller unit (MCU) developed by NXP Semiconductors, commonly used in automotive and industrial applications.

  2. Question: What are the key features of SPC5516EBMLQ66?
    Answer: Some key features of SPC5516EBMLQ66 include a 32-bit Power Architecture® e200z4 core, on-chip flash memory, multiple communication interfaces, and various peripherals for system integration.

  3. Question: In which industries is SPC5516EBMLQ66 commonly used?
    Answer: SPC5516EBMLQ66 is commonly used in automotive systems, such as engine control units (ECUs), body control modules (BCMs), and advanced driver-assistance systems (ADAS). It is also utilized in industrial automation and control applications.

  4. Question: What is the maximum clock frequency supported by SPC5516EBMLQ66?
    Answer: SPC5516EBMLQ66 supports a maximum clock frequency of up to 80 MHz.

  5. Question: Can SPC5516EBMLQ66 interface with external devices?
    Answer: Yes, SPC5516EBMLQ66 provides various communication interfaces, including CAN, LIN, FlexRay, SPI, I2C, and UART, allowing it to interface with external devices.

  6. Question: How much flash memory does SPC5516EBMLQ66 have?
    Answer: SPC5516EBMLQ66 has 1 MB of on-chip flash memory for program storage.

  7. Question: What is the operating voltage range of SPC5516EBMLQ66?
    Answer: SPC5516EBMLQ66 operates within a voltage range of 3.0V to 5.5V.

  8. Question: Does SPC5516EBMLQ66 support real-time operating systems (RTOS)?
    Answer: Yes, SPC5516EBMLQ66 is compatible with various RTOS options, allowing for efficient multitasking and real-time processing.

  9. Question: Can SPC5516EBMLQ66 be used in safety-critical applications?
    Answer: Yes, SPC5516EBMLQ66 is designed to meet automotive safety standards, such as ISO 26262, making it suitable for safety-critical applications.

  10. Question: Are development tools available for programming SPC5516EBMLQ66?
    Answer: Yes, NXP provides a comprehensive set of development tools, including compilers, debuggers, and integrated development environments (IDEs), to facilitate programming and debugging of SPC5516EBMLQ66-based solutions.

Please note that these questions and answers are general and may vary depending on specific application requirements and use cases.